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

date-picker-svelte

Package Overview
Dependencies
Maintainers
1
Versions
38
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

date-picker-svelte - npm Package Compare versions

Comparing version 2.3.0 to 2.4.0

dist/date-utils.d.ts

132

package.json
{
"name": "date-picker-svelte",
"version": "2.3.0",
"version": "2.4.0",
"description": "Date and time picker for Svelte",
"type": "module",
"scripts": {
"dev": "vite dev",
"build": "vite build && npm run package",
"build:site": "vite build",
"preview": "vite preview",
"package": "svelte-package",
"prepublishOnly": "npm run package",
"lint": "svelte-kit sync && svelte-check --tsconfig ./tsconfig.json && eslint src && prettier --check src",
"format": "prettier --write src && eslint --fix src",
"test": "vitest",
"test:coverage": "vitest --coverage"
},
"devDependencies": {
"@sveltejs/adapter-static": "^1.0.0",
"@sveltejs/kit": "^1.0.0",
"@sveltejs/package": "^1.0.0",
"@typescript-eslint/eslint-plugin": "^5.46.1",
"@typescript-eslint/parser": "^5.46.1",
"babel-jest": "^29.3.1",
"@sveltejs/adapter-static": "^2.0.2",
"@sveltejs/kit": "^1.15.9",
"@sveltejs/package": "^2.0.2",
"@typescript-eslint/eslint-plugin": "^5.59.1",
"@typescript-eslint/parser": "^5.59.1",
"@vitest/coverage-c8": "^0.30.1",
"date-fns": "^2.29.3",
"eslint": "^8.29.0",
"eslint-config-prettier": "^8.5.0",
"eslint-plugin-svelte3": "^4.0.0",
"jest": "^29.3.1",
"eslint": "^8.39.0",
"eslint-config-prettier": "^8.8.0",
"eslint-plugin-svelte": "^2.27.1",
"mdsvex": "^0.10.6",
"prettier": "^2.8.1",
"prettier-plugin-svelte": "^2.9.0",
"sass": "^1.56.2",
"svelte": "^3.55.0",
"svelte-check": "^2.10.2",
"ts-jest": "^29.0.3",
"typescript": "^4.9.4",
"vite": "^4.0.1"
"prettier": "^2.8.8",
"prettier-plugin-svelte": "^2.10.0",
"sass": "^1.62.1",
"svelte": "^3.58.0",
"svelte-check": "^3.2.0",
"typescript": "^5.0.4",
"vite": "^4.3.3",
"vitest": "^0.30.1"
},

@@ -31,2 +42,61 @@ "peerDependencies": {

},
"exports": {
"./package.json": "./package.json",
"./DateInput.svelte": {
"types": "./dist/DateInput.svelte.d.ts",
"svelte": "./dist/DateInput.svelte",
"default": "./dist/DateInput.svelte"
},
"./DatePicker.svelte": {
"types": "./dist/DatePicker.svelte.d.ts",
"svelte": "./dist/DatePicker.svelte",
"default": "./dist/DatePicker.svelte"
},
"./date-utils": {
"types": "./dist/date-utils.d.ts",
"default": "./dist/date-utils.js"
},
".": {
"types": "./dist/index.d.ts",
"svelte": "./dist/index.js",
"default": "./dist/index.js"
},
"./locale": {
"types": "./dist/locale.d.ts",
"default": "./dist/locale.js"
},
"./parse": {
"types": "./dist/parse.d.ts",
"default": "./dist/parse.js"
}
},
"files": [
"dist",
"!dist/**/*.test.*",
"!dist/**/*.spec.*"
],
"svelte": "./dist/index.js",
"types": "./dist/index.d.ts",
"typesVersions": {
">4.0": {
"DateInput.svelte": [
"./dist/DateInput.svelte.d.ts"
],
"DatePicker.svelte": [
"./dist/DatePicker.svelte.d.ts"
],
"date-utils": [
"./dist/date-utils.d.ts"
],
"index": [
"./dist/index.d.ts"
],
"locale": [
"./dist/locale.d.ts"
],
"parse": [
"./dist/parse.d.ts"
]
}
},
"license": "MIT",

@@ -55,12 +125,2 @@ "homepage": "https://date-picker-svelte.kasper.space",

],
"jest": {
"transform": {
"^.+\\.ts$": "ts-jest",
"^.+\\.js$": "babel-jest"
},
"moduleFileExtensions": [
"js",
"ts"
]
},
"prettier": {

@@ -73,13 +133,3 @@ "printWidth": 100,

]
},
"exports": {
"./package.json": "./package.json",
"./DateInput.svelte": "./DateInput.svelte",
"./DatePicker.svelte": "./DatePicker.svelte",
"./date-utils": "./date-utils.js",
".": "./index.js",
"./locale": "./locale.js",
"./parse": "./parse.js"
},
"svelte": "./index.js"
}
}
}

@@ -67,11 +67,7 @@ # Date Picker Svelte

```
4. Generate the package
4. Publish
```
npm run build:package
npm publish
```
5. Publish the package
```
npm publish ./package
```
6. Commit with a tag in format "v#.#.#"
7. Create GitHub release with release notes
5. Commit with a tag in format "v#.#.#"
6. Create GitHub release with release notes
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c